President Lee Requests Resubmission of Kang Sunwoo's Confirmation Report by the 24th... Appointment Process Begins

Requests Also Made for Reports on Ahn Kyubaek as Minister of National Defense,
Kwon Oeul as Minister of Patriots and Veterans Affairs,
and Chung Dongyoung as Minister of Unification

On July 22, President Lee Jaemyung requested the National Assembly to resend the confirmation hearing reports for four ministerial nominees, including Kang Sunwoo, the nominee for Minister of Gender Equality and Family, by July 24.

Presidential spokesperson Kang Yujeong announced during a briefing at the Yongsan presidential office that the National Assembly was asked to resend the confirmation hearing reports for Kang Sunwoo, Ahn Kyubaek (nominee for Minister of National Defense), Kwon Oeul (nominee for Minister of Patriots and Veterans Affairs), and Chung Dongyoung (nominee for Minister of Unification) by July 24.


Spokesperson Kang explained, "The deadline for resending the confirmation reports was set for July 24, taking into account Article 6 of the Confirmation Hearing Act, which stipulates the period for resubmission requests, past precedents, and the fact that the deadline requested by the nominees for Minister of National Defense and Minister of Patriots and Veterans Affairs falls on Saturday, the 26th of this week."


According to the Confirmation Hearing Act, the National Assembly must complete the confirmation hearing within 20 days of receiving the request. If the confirmation report is not adopted within this period, the president may request resubmission within a specified period of up to 10 days. If the report is still not adopted within the resubmission period, the president may appoint the ministerial nominee.
